Similarly one may ask, how do I check if a company is registered in the US?

In the United States, all corporations are registered with the individual states where they do business. There is no registration at the national level. To look up registration information of a U.S. company, you need to search the database of the state or states where it is registered.

Who needs to register with the SEC?

Generally only larger advisers that have $25 million or more of assets under management or that provide advice to investment company clients are permitted to register with the Commission. Smaller advisers register under state law with state securities authorities.

Do private companies have to register with the SEC?

Registration of securities under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 is something that many private companies have put out of their minds until the market improves. However, for private companies with over 500 stockholders or option holders, registration under the Exchange Act is a requirement, not a choice.

What is SEC issuer?

An issuer is a legal entity that develops, registers and sells securities to finance its operations. Issuers may be corporations, investment trusts, or domestic or foreign governments.

What is the SEC and why was it created?

The Securities And Exchange Commission (SEC) was created in 1934 to help restore investor confidence in the wake of the 1929 stock market crash. The SEC consists of five divisions and 24 offices.

Why is crowd1 banned?

Firstly, in September, the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A), issued a warning cautioning the public that Crowd1 was a pyramid scheme. In Namibia, it was banned by the country's central bank, after being accused of being a pyramid scheme.

Is crowd1 banned in the Philippines?

SEC Philippines Declares Cease And Desist Order Against Crowd1 Permanent. The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has made permanent its order stopping CROWD1 Asia Pacific, Inc. from soliciting and accepting investments from the public under a scheme disguised as a digital marketing business.
